V. V. Balagansky is a scholar working on Geophysics, Artificial Intelligence and Geochemistry and Petrology. According to data from OpenAlex, V. V. Balagansky has authored 29 papers receiving a total of 714 indexed citations (citations by other indexed papers that have themselves been cited), including 28 papers in Geophysics, 14 papers in Artificial Intelligence and 6 papers in Geochemistry and Petrology. Recurrent topics in V. V. Balagansky's work include Geological and Geochemical Analysis (27 papers), Geochemistry and Geologic Mapping (14 papers) and High-pressure geophysics and materials (14 papers). V. V. Balagansky is often cited by papers focused on Geological and Geochemical Analysis (27 papers), Geochemistry and Geologic Mapping (14 papers) and High-pressure geophysics and materials (14 papers). V. V. Balagansky collaborates with scholars based in Russia, Finland and Sweden. V. V. Balagansky's co-authors include Martin J. Whitehouse, Martin J. Timmerman, J. Stephen Daly, А. И. Слабунов, P. Sorjonen-Ward, A. A. Shchipansky, D. Bridgwater, P. Peltonen, S. Mertanen and Adam A. Garde and has published in prestigious journals such as SHILAP Revista de lepidopterología, Tectonophysics and Precambrian Research.
